HP on melee doesn't make much of a different is you take a big hit, but it can help keep you topped off. I was healing around 12 HP per melee poke with a spear.
The HP steal spell is mostly useless most of the time. However, if you cast it right before landing a fatal blow, it can heal a huge chunk. Against some enemies, I was getting back around 200 HP if I casted it before a fatal blow.

HP regen is extremely plentiful in this game. You can upgrade the potion. At maximum it will be 10 charges that heal 400HP each. On top of that you can use 9x dragon cure's powder that restore pretty much max hp each. I think you might be able to get them from something, dont recall what.
Even without them tho, its still 4,000HP healing with regular potions. I'm honestly surprised they have this much healing. Its way too much imo.
There was a side mission in Part 3 that took place in a lake-like setting. Hong Jing is your companion there. Right at the beginning, there's a rock pillar that you can climb up on that has the Dragon Cure Powder. And you should be able to go to the travel map and reload the mission.
